FingerMotion, Inc., a mobile data specialist company, provides mobile payment and recharge platform system in China.
FingerMotion, Inc. in the Communication Services sector is trading at $0.41 with a market capitalization of $57M. The stock is currently near its 52-week low of $0.39, remaining 66.2% below its 200-day moving average. On fundamentals, Piotroski 3/9 flags weak fundamentals, Altman Z in the distress zone. Risk note: RSI 12 is oversold, raising the odds of a near-term bounce; MACD remains below its signal line. The Whystock Score of 45/100 suggests a balanced risk-reward profile.
